Echocardiography Course

 

SevernFUSIC is aimed at all trainees & consultants who want to utilise ultrasound in the care of acutely and critically ill patients

The 1 day echocardiography course offers lectures and workshops with nearly 4 hours of hands-on scanning practice in groups of 3 to maximise learning and motor skills

We are accredited for 5 CPD points from the Royal College of Anaesthetists

Our expert faculty is formed of FUSIC mentors, supervisors and BSE qualified clinicians from the Severn region that utilise echo regularly in their professional practice

The cost is only £200 for the day and includes lunch and refreshments

 

The course will teach you how to:

  • Achieve the 4 standard echo (TTE) views: parasternal long axis, parasternal short axis, apical 4 chamber and subcostal
  • Interpret the images obtained
  • Diagnose potentially treatable causes of cardiac arrest & circulatory collapse, such as pericardial collection, tamponade, pulmonary embolus and hypovolaemia
  • Understand the pitfalls and limitations of focused echocardiography
  • Understand the requirements & mechanisms for achieving FUSIC accreditation

Lectures and workshops include:

  • Basic physics, optimal image acquisition and sonoanatomy
  • FUSIC heart examination
  • Assessment of filling, ventricular function and common pathologies
  • Hands on sessions
  • Interesting clinical cases
  • Achieving FUSIC heart accreditation as a trainee

L.A.V. Course

 

The Severn FUSIC Lung, Abdomen and Vascular course is aimed at all trainees & consultants who want to utilise ultrasonography in the care of acutely and critically ill patients.

Our course offers:

  • Experienced radiologists, sonographers and FUSIC qualified Faculty
  • 3 hours of hands-on practice in small groups to maximise hands-on learning
  • RCOA 5 CPD
  • Very competitively priced – only £200 for the day

 

The course will teach you how to:

  • Perform ultrasound guided vascular access, lung ultrasound, abdominal ultrasound and vascular ultrasound (DVT detection)
  • Interpret obtained images: diagnosis of potentially treatable causes of cardiac arrest & circulatory collapse (pneumothorax, pleural effusion, pulmonary oedema, DVT)
  • Understand the pitfalls and limitations of focused ultrasonography on ICU
  • Understand the requirements & mechanisms for achieving FUSIC LAV accreditation

 

Topics include:

  • Optimal image acquisition and sonoanatomy
  • Lung and abdominal ultrasound examination
  • DVT and vascular access
  • Plenty of hands on scanning practice
  • Completing FUSIC LAV accreditation
